Comprehensive Emissions Management and Environmental Compliance
Emission Management helps companies measure, track, and monitor air, water, and waste emissions to reduce financial and operational risks, improve brand image, and mitigate non-conformance costs.
It provides companies a single “source of the truth” in order to stay up to date with ever changing environmental regulations. It provides different views of emissions data across all regions – at both the plant and the corporate levels and helps to boost efficiency and reduce non-conformance risk.
The software enables tracking and monitoring of emissions and pollutant discharges at the plant, equipment, or production process level. With functionality that supports automated emissions calculations, detection of key thresholds, and accurate reporting, the solution helps companies achieve both internal and external transparency requirements.
